Oct 18, 2021Tires

The contact owns a 2013 GMC SIERRA 2500 equipped with Cooper Tires, Tire Line: Discoverer A/T3 XLT, Tire Size: 265/60/R20, DOT Number: UT6K1MJ. The contact stated that the side walls were dry rotted and were separating. The contact took the tires back to the tire shop where the tires were purchased, and it was confirmed that the tires needed to be replaced. The tires had not been replaced. The manufacturer was made aware of the failure. The approximate failure mileage on the vehicle was 119,192, and the tire failure mileage was 190,000.

Apr 19, 2017Tires

RUNNING ERRANDS WITHOUT PULLING A LOAD AND EMPTY BED OF TRUCK. AT A STOP AND WHEN GREEN BEGAN TO ACCELERATE, RIGHT BACK TIRE BLOW OUT, NO INJURIES PULLED OVER TO A SAFE SPOT TO CHANGE TIRE. NO DISCERNIBLE DEFECTS BEFORE USING TRUCK THIS DAY. ORIGINAL TIRES TO TRUCK, APPROXIMATELY 50,000 K MILES, VERY LITTLE HEAVY USE FOR THIS TRUCK.

Feb 5, 2015Tires

FIRST INCIDENT -BFGOODRICH MUD TERRAIN KM2 TIRE TREAD SEPARATED FROM TIRE CAUSING DAMAGE TO RUNNING BOARD ON RIGHT FRONT. WAS ON INTERSTATE GOING ABOUT 55 MPH. SECOND INCIDENT- 1 OF ORIGINAL SET OF 4 IS NOW ON BACK AGAIN ON INTERSTATE GOING APPROXIMATELY 65 MPH TIRE SEPARATED AND CAUSED DAMAGE TO RIGHT FENDER. *TR

How to use these: a complaint is one owner’s report, filed voluntarily and published unverified. Patterns matter more than any single story. If several owners describe the same failure at similar mileage, put that system at the top of your pre-purchase inspection list. Back to the full 2013 GMC Sierra 2500 Hd verdict →
